In the course of changing out the radiator in this car, I discovered that the trans fluid is cooked. I've found lots of good info in these forums on changing the fluid, but since this is my first time doing it I want to make sure of something: Is the drain plug the 24mm brass fitting that faces the to the right (pass side)? Also, I read about replacing the aluminum washer when reinstalling the plug. Will a generic washer from any auto parts store do, or is this a Volvo specific item? By the way, I'm assuming it's a crush washer. Is that correct?

For any other XC70 neophyte who may have these same questions in the future, the answers are: Yes, that is the plug; yes generic will do - no need for a Volvo-specific washer; and yes, it is a crush washer.
